Domcttio fowlB would 1)0 of a great utility in ft field of crowing corn or potatoes, and especial ly bo in tlio garden, if they could bo kept from tcratcliiug up the plants. With a flock of poultry running among tlio vines Ihorc would ho no trouble from bug?. A long timo sinco we gave in tho .IgricuUu rist a plan for attaching a jointed fpur to the back fido of tlio legs of a hen, bo that whon sho attempted to scratch, tho falsa tpur would catch m tho ground and throw her forward"; Bho would thus speedily scratch herself out of tho prem ises. This wa cousidcrod a very inge nious arrangement, though not n. very practicable one. But hero is a remedy, both ingeuious and practicable, and what is still better, it docs not send-the fowl nway, but leaves her to gather tho insects, and prevents her doing any harm with her feet For tho idea we aro indebted to the following paragraph, which wo find in an exchange credited to tho Rural In telligencer t " A friend of ours boardiug in the country, found his hostess ono morn ing busily engaged in making numerous biuall woolen bags of singular shape. Upon inrmiry, ho was enformed that they were shoes for hens, to prevent them from scratching. Tho lady Mated that it had been her practice for years to shoo her hens, and save her garden. These shoes (I believe they aro not patented) wore of woolen, made somewhat of the shapo of a fowls foot, after which they wero closed with a needio and bowed tightly on, ex tending about an inch up the leg. Our friend observed that bouio of the biddies, possibly conceited with their now honors, appeared to tread as though walking on eggs praticuluarly was this the case when, from tho width of the ehoo one would conceiao that their toes might bo pinch ed." Now is not that a 'capital idea 2 How taiy it is to sew pieces of thin strong colth around the feet of a dozen or twenty, or fifty fowls, in the form of a bag, leading it loose enough not to obstruct tho uso of the feet in walking and in roosting, but making it tight euougli around the leg to prevent its slipping off. Tlio animals may then bo allowed to run at largo and gather grasshoppers and other destructivo in flects. "Wo shall put tho plan into iniuic diato practice, and iucrcaso our stock of poultry to tho undoubted advantage of our plants, now infested with myriads of insect pests. American Agriculturist.
